The Process: What to Expect

Data Setup & Document Gathering (Pre-Meeting)

After signing the advisory agreement, you'll receive access to professional planning software and a comprehensive data gathering checklist. This phase includes entering financial data and uploading key documents.

Goal: Establish a complete financial foundation before the first meeting.

1

Meeting 1: Vision & Discovery (75-90 minutes)

"What does La Vida (the good life) mean to YOU?" This meeting explores your life values, priorities, and goals. We validate financial data, identify pain points, and discuss what success looks like for you.

Topics covered:

  • Life values exploration and priorities discussion
  • Comprehensive data validation
  • Goal identification and success metrics
  • Financial concerns and decision-making preferences

Deliverable: Values-Based Spending Exercise (homework for deeper insights)

2

Meeting 2: Financial Ecosystem (75-90 minutes)

"Understanding where you are": Deep dive into your complete financial picture including balance sheet, cash flow, and existing planning foundation.

Topics covered:

  • Balance sheet analysis (assets, liabilities, net worth by tax location)
  • Cash flow analysis with values-based spending review
  • Debt strategy analysis
  • Employee benefits review
  • Estate document summary and beneficiary review

Deliverable: Current Financial Ecosystem section draft

3

Meeting 3: Risk & Protection (60-75 minutes)

"Building the foundation before building wealth": Comprehensive risk management analysis ensuring you're properly protected before focusing on wealth building.

Topics covered:

  • Life insurance needs analysis
  • Disability income protection review
  • Health insurance strategy (including HSA optimization)
  • Property & casualty review (home, auto, umbrella)
  • Long-term care planning discussion

Deliverable: Risk Management & Insurance section draft

4

Meeting 4: Wealth Building & Independence (90-120 minutes)

"The path TO and THROUGH financial independence": Investment strategy, retirement projections, and tax optimization tailored to your situation.

Topics covered:

  • Investment accounts summary and allocation review
  • Asset allocation education and personalized strategy
  • Retirement projections with Monte Carlo scenarios
  • Savings order of operations (personalized roadmap)
  • Tax optimization strategies (Roth conversions, tax-loss harvesting, charitable giving)
  • Education funding analysis (if applicable)

Deliverable: Savings & Investments + Financial Independence Planning sections draft

5

Meeting 5: Plan Delivery & Action Roadmap (75-90 minutes)

"Confidence to implement your well-informed decisions": Presentation of the complete plan with clear priorities and implementation guidance.

Topics covered:

  • Complete plan document review and walkthrough
  • Planning software review with key scenarios
  • Income tax summary and forward-looking strategy
  • Additional observations and recommendations
  • Future engagement options discussion

Deliverable: Complete Comprehensive Financial Plan Document (PDF) + Planning Software Access + Measurable Action Plan (MAP) with 90-day priorities
